本發明是有關於一種風扇,特別是指一種吸震風扇。The present invention relates to a fan, and more particularly to a shock absorbing fan.

散熱風扇的應用範圍領域廣泛,舉凡電子儀器,工業產品,甚至是近年來炙手可熱的CPU,都可以見到散熱風扇的延伸應用。The application range of the cooling fan is extensive, and the extended applications of the cooling fan can be seen in electronic instruments, industrial products, and even the hot CPUs in recent years.

但是,受限於製造精度、組裝誤差、轉速以及負載等因素,現有散熱風扇在運轉時常會伴隨著產生震動,而且一般而言,現有散熱風扇的殼座是鎖合於如電腦機殼或散熱鰭片的一安裝結構上,因此,當該散熱風扇產生震動時,會造成該殼座與安裝結構因相互撞擊而引發噪音影響生活品質,特別是長期面對充滿噪音的環境,更易產生對心理及生理之不良影響。However, due to factors such as manufacturing accuracy, assembly error, rotational speed, and load, existing cooling fans are often accompanied by vibrations during operation, and in general, the housing of the existing cooling fan is locked to a computer case or heat sink. A mounting structure of the fins, therefore, when the cooling fan generates vibration, the housing and the mounting structure may cause noise to affect the quality of life due to mutual impact, especially in a long-term environment full of noise, which is more likely to generate psychology. And the adverse effects of physiology.

參閱圖1,為了改善因震動所產生的噪音,相關業者研發出如美國第US7189053號專利案所揭露的技術,其改善之處在於:利用一設置架2環繞一風扇1,同時以彈性材質所製成的薄膜3連接於該設置架2與該風扇1之間,其中,該風扇1包括一殼座11,及一轉動地樞設於該殼座11中的扇輪12,且該殼座11的外周緣與該設置架2的內周緣相對凸設有一結合件13,而該薄膜3的相反二側緣則形成有與該二結合件13相互配合的卡溝31,利用該二卡溝31與該二結合件13相結合,使該薄膜3連接於該設置架2的內周緣與該殼座11的外周緣上,以吸收該殼座11的震動避免 產生噪音。Referring to Fig. 1, in order to improve the noise caused by the vibration, the related art has developed a technique disclosed in the U.S. Patent No. 7,819,053, which is improved by using a setting frame 2 to surround a fan 1 while being made of an elastic material. The formed film 3 is connected between the mounting frame 2 and the fan 1. The fan 1 includes a housing 11 and a fan wheel 12 pivotally mounted in the housing 11 and the housing A coupling member 13 is protruded from the outer periphery of the mounting frame 2, and the opposite side edges of the film 3 are formed with a latching groove 31 that cooperates with the two coupling members 13. 31 is combined with the two coupling members 13 to connect the film 3 to the inner circumference of the mounting frame 2 and the outer circumference of the housing 11 to absorb the vibration of the housing 11 to avoid generates noise.

利用連接於該設置架2之內周緣與該殼座11之外周緣上的薄膜3,雖能吸收該殼座11的震動以避免噪音的產生,但仍具有下列缺點有待改善:The film 3 attached to the outer periphery of the mounting frame 2 and the outer periphery of the housing 11 can absorb the vibration of the housing 11 to avoid noise, but still has the following disadvantages to be improved:

1.組裝不便:由於該薄膜3是位於該設置架2的內周緣與該殼座11的外周緣之間,因此,在組裝時不易觀察該薄膜3上之所述卡溝31與相對應之結合件13的相對位置,導致在組裝上較為不便。1. Inconvenient assembly: since the film 3 is located between the inner periphery of the mounting frame 2 and the outer periphery of the housing 11, the card groove 31 on the film 3 is not easily observed during assembly and corresponds to The relative position of the joint members 13 results in inconvenience in assembly.

2.成本較高:為了使該薄膜3能連接於該設置架2的內周緣與該殼座11的外周緣上,必須額外於該殼座11的外周緣與該設置架2的內周緣凸設結合件13,並於該薄膜3的相反二側緣形成有與該二結合件13相互配合的卡溝31,製造程序上較為複雜,相對的生產製造成本也較高。2. High cost: in order to connect the film 3 to the inner circumference of the mounting frame 2 and the outer circumference of the housing 11, it is necessary to additionally attach to the outer circumference of the housing 11 and the inner circumference of the mounting bracket 2 The coupling member 13 is provided, and the groove 31 which cooperates with the two coupling members 13 is formed on the opposite side edges of the film 3, which is complicated in manufacturing procedure and relatively high in manufacturing cost.

3.體積較大:由於所述結合件13是凸設於該殼座11的外周緣與該設置架2的內周緣上,且該薄膜3又是位於該殼座11的外周緣與該設置架2的內周緣之間,造成該殼座11與該設置架2間的間距大增,不但使得整體的橫向體積較大而造成空間的浪費,相對的也僅能用於空間較大的地方。3. The volume is larger: since the coupling member 13 is protruded from the outer periphery of the housing 11 and the inner circumference of the mounting frame 2, and the film 3 is located at the outer periphery of the housing 11 and the arrangement Between the inner circumferences of the frame 2, the spacing between the housing 11 and the installation frame 2 is greatly increased, which not only makes the overall lateral volume larger, but also wastes space, and can only be used for a large space. .

因此,本發明之目的,即在提供一種可以吸收震動且降低噪音的吸震風扇。Accordingly, it is an object of the present invention to provide a shock absorbing fan that can absorb vibration and reduce noise.

於是,本發明吸震風扇,包含一殼座、一扇輪、一間隔環繞於該殼座外周緣的外框,及一連接該殼座與該外框 的吸震單元。Therefore, the shock absorbing fan of the present invention comprises a housing, a fan wheel, an outer frame spaced around the outer periphery of the housing, and a connecting the housing and the outer frame Shock absorber unit.

該殼座具有一基壁,及一環繞連設於該基壁周緣的圍壁,該圍壁具有一自該基壁周緣向上延伸的第一延伸部,及一自該基壁周緣向下延伸的第二延伸部。The housing has a base wall and a surrounding wall connected to the periphery of the base wall, the surrounding wall has a first extending portion extending upward from a periphery of the base wall, and a downward extending from a periphery of the base wall The second extension.

該扇輪樞設於該殼座之基壁上。The fan wheel is pivotally disposed on a base wall of the housing.

該吸震單元包括一設置於該殼座之第二延伸部端緣且圍繞該扇輪的第一結合件、一設置於該外框頂緣且圍繞該殼座的第二結合件,及多數個相間隔地連接該第一結合件與該第二結合件的吸震件,其中,所述吸震件是以彈性材料所製成。The shock absorbing unit includes a first coupling member disposed on the second extending end edge of the housing and surrounding the fan wheel, a second coupling member disposed on the top edge of the outer frame and surrounding the housing, and a plurality of The first coupling member and the shock absorbing member of the second coupling member are connected at intervals, wherein the shock absorbing member is made of an elastic material.

本發明之功效是利用以彈性材料所製成的吸震件吸收該殼座因該扇輪轉動時所引起的震動,有效降低因震動所產生的噪音;而且由於該吸震單元之第一、二結合件是分別設置於該殼座底緣與該外框頂緣,不但組裝上較為方便迅捷,而且製造成本低,體積也能相對縮小。The utility model has the advantages that the shock absorbing member made of the elastic material absorbs the vibration caused by the rotation of the sliding seat of the housing, thereby effectively reducing the noise generated by the vibration; and because the first and second combination of the shock absorbing unit The components are respectively disposed on the bottom edge of the shell and the top edge of the outer frame, which is convenient and quick to assemble, and has low manufacturing cost and relatively small volume.

參閱圖2與圖3,本發明吸震風扇4之較佳實施例包含一殼座41、一樞設於該殼座41中的扇輪42、一間隔環繞於該殼座41外周緣的外框43,及一連接該殼座41與該外框43的吸震單元44。Referring to FIG. 2 and FIG. 3, a preferred embodiment of the shock absorbing fan 4 of the present invention comprises a housing 41, a fan wheel 42 pivoted in the housing 41, and a frame spaced around the outer periphery of the housing 41. 43. A shock absorbing unit 44 that connects the housing 41 and the outer frame 43.

該殼座41具有一基壁411,及一環繞連設於該基壁411 周緣的圍壁412,該圍壁412具有一自該基壁411周緣向上延伸的第一延伸部413,及一自該基壁411周緣向下延伸的第二延伸部414,其中,該扇輪42是樞設於基壁411上。The housing 41 has a base wall 411 and a surrounding connection to the base wall 411 a peripheral wall 412 having a first extending portion 413 extending upward from a periphery of the base wall 411 and a second extending portion 414 extending downward from a periphery of the base wall 411, wherein the surrounding wheel 42 is pivotally disposed on the base wall 411.

該外框43具有一位於頂緣的第一端部431,及一相反於該第一端部431的第二端部432。The outer frame 43 has a first end 431 at the top edge and a second end 432 opposite the first end 431.

該吸震單元44包括一設置於該圍壁412之第二延伸部414端緣且圍繞該扇輪42的第一結合件441、一設置於該外框43頂緣且圍繞該殼座41的第二結合件442,及多數個相間隔地連接該第一結合件441與該第二結合件442的吸震件443,其中,該第一結合件441具有一與該圍壁412之第二延伸部414端緣相配合的第一卡溝444,而該第二結合件442具有一與該外框43之第一端部431頂緣相配合且面向該第一卡溝444的第二卡溝445,該圍壁412之第二延伸部414端緣是卡設於該第一卡溝444中,而該外框43之第一端部431頂緣是卡設於該第二卡溝445中,且所述吸震件443是以彈性材料所製成。The shock absorbing unit 44 includes a first joint member 441 disposed at an end edge of the second extending portion 414 of the surrounding wall 412 and surrounding the fan wheel 42. The first joint member 441 disposed on the top edge of the outer frame 43 and surrounding the shell seat 41 a second coupling member 442, and a plurality of shock absorbing members 443 that are spaced apart from the first coupling member 441 and the second coupling member 442, wherein the first coupling member 441 has a second extension portion with the surrounding wall 412 The second engaging member 442 has a first engaging groove 444, and the second engaging member 442 has a second receiving groove 445 which cooperates with the top edge of the first end portion 431 of the outer frame 43 and faces the first receiving groove 444. The edge of the second extending portion 414 of the surrounding wall 412 is disposed in the first card groove 444, and the top edge of the first end portion 431 of the outer frame 43 is locked in the second card groove 445. And the shock absorbing member 443 is made of an elastic material.

於本較佳實施例中,該第一、二結合件441、442及所述吸震件443皆是以彈性體所製成,且所述吸震件443概呈長條狀以連接該第一結合件441與該第二結合件442,但是在實際應用上所述吸震件443只要是以橡膠、塑膠...等彈性材料所製成,即可達成相同的功效,並不應為本實施例的揭露所囿限。In the preferred embodiment, the first and second coupling members 441 and 442 and the shock absorbing member 443 are all made of an elastic body, and the shock absorbing member 443 is elongated to connect the first combination. The member 441 and the second coupling member 442, but in actual application, the shock absorbing member 443 can be made of an elastic material such as rubber, plastic, etc., and the same effect can be achieved, and should not be the embodiment. The limits of the disclosure.

此外,值得一提的是,於本較佳實施例中,該第一、二結合件441、442與所述吸震件443是以相同的材質所製 成,所以可以利用一體成型的方式加以製造,當然該第一、二結合件441、442的材質也可以與所述吸震件443的材質不同,而於分別成型後再加以連接,只要所述吸震件443是以彈性材料所製成即可達成相同的功效,並不為本實施例的揭露所限。In addition, it is worth mentioning that, in the preferred embodiment, the first and second coupling members 441 and 442 and the shock absorbing member 443 are made of the same material. Therefore, it can be manufactured by integral molding. Of course, the materials of the first and second coupling members 441 and 442 may be different from the material of the shock absorbing member 443, and then connected after being separately formed, as long as the shock absorption is performed. The member 443 is made of an elastic material to achieve the same effect, and is not limited by the disclosure of the embodiment.

藉由上述設計,本發明之吸震風扇4在實際使用時,具有下列優點:With the above design, the shock absorbing fan 4 of the present invention has the following advantages in actual use:

1.所產生的震動與噪音小:該吸震風扇4運作時可利用以彈性材料所製成的所述吸震件443吸收該殼座41因該扇輪42轉動時所引起的震動,不但能有效緩和震動,更能避免因震動引發撞擊所產生的噪音。1. The generated vibration and noise are small: when the shock absorbing fan 4 is in operation, the shock absorbing member 443 made of an elastic material can absorb the vibration caused by the rotation of the housing 41 due to the rotation of the fan wheel 42, which is effective not only effective To alleviate the vibration, it is more able to avoid the noise caused by the shock caused by the vibration.

2.組裝方便:由於該吸震單元44之第一、二結合件441、442是分別以該第一卡溝444與第二卡溝445結合於該圍壁412之第二延伸部414端緣與該外框43之第一端部431頂緣,因此在組裝時可清楚且準確地對準該第一、二卡溝444、445與該第二延伸部414端緣及該第一端部431頂緣間的相對位置,不但便於組裝更能有效加快組裝速度。2. The assembly is convenient: since the first and second coupling members 441 and 442 of the shock absorbing unit 44 are respectively coupled to the edge of the second extending portion 414 of the surrounding wall 412 by the first and second receiving grooves 444 and 445, The first end portion 431 of the outer frame 43 has a top edge, so that the first and second card grooves 444, 445 and the second extending portion 414 end edge and the first end portion 431 can be clearly and accurately aligned during assembly. The relative position between the top edges not only facilitates assembly, but also speeds up assembly.

3.生產成本低:續上述,由於該吸震單元44是直接結合於該圍壁412之第二延伸部414與該外框43之第一端部431上,毋需變更現有殼座41之設計,亦毋需於該圍壁412或該外框43上額外增加任何構件,有效簡化生產製造的流程以降低生產成本。3. Low production cost: Since the shock absorbing unit 44 is directly coupled to the second extending portion 414 of the surrounding wall 412 and the first end portion 431 of the outer frame 43, the design of the existing housing 41 needs to be changed. It is also unnecessary to add any additional components to the surrounding wall 412 or the outer frame 43, which simplifies the manufacturing process and reduces the production cost.

4.體積小:續上述,由於該吸震單元44是結合於該圍壁412之第二延伸部414端緣與該外框43之第一端部431 頂緣,而不是連接於該圍壁412與該外框43的內、外周緣之間,相對的該圍壁412或該外框43周緣也毋需增設任何用以結合該吸震單元44的構件,因此,能有效縮小該圍壁412與該外框43之間的間距,使得整體體積縮小,有效避免空間浪費,且便於安裝使用。4. Small in size: continued, since the shock absorbing unit 44 is coupled to the end edge of the second extending portion 414 of the surrounding wall 412 and the first end portion 431 of the outer frame 43 The top edge, instead of being connected between the surrounding wall 412 and the inner and outer circumferences of the outer frame 43, the opposing surrounding wall 412 or the outer periphery of the outer frame 43 is also required to add any member for joining the shock absorbing unit 44. Therefore, the spacing between the surrounding wall 412 and the outer frame 43 can be effectively reduced, so that the overall volume is reduced, space waste is effectively avoided, and installation and use are facilitated.

綜上所述,本發明吸震風扇4,利用該吸震單元44中以彈性材料所製成的吸震件443吸收該殼座41因該扇輪42轉動時所引起的震動,有效降低因震動所產生的噪音;而且由於該吸震單元44之第一、二結合件441、442是分別設置於該殼座41底緣與該外框43頂緣,不但在組裝上較為方便簡單,更能簡化生產製造的流程以降低生產成本,並有效縮小整體體積以避免空間浪費,亦便於安裝使用,故確實能達成本發明之目的。In summary, the shock absorbing fan 4 of the present invention absorbs the vibration caused by the rotation of the fan wheel 42 by the shock absorbing member 443 made of an elastic material in the shock absorbing unit 44, thereby effectively reducing the vibration. And the first and second coupling members 441 and 442 of the shock absorbing unit 44 are respectively disposed on the bottom edge of the housing 41 and the top edge of the outer frame 43, which is convenient and simple to assemble, and simplifies manufacturing. The process of the present invention can be achieved by reducing the production cost and effectively reducing the overall volume to avoid space waste and also facilitating installation and use.
